1. Article Text Extractor API
The Article Text Extractor API provides fast and easy extraction of clean text and structured data from news and blog articles. It effectively removes ads, links, and other unwanted content, allowing users to focus on the main content of the article. This API is particularly useful for natural language processing (NLP) and data analysis tasks.
Key features include:
- Text Extractor: This feature allows users to extract the main article text along with metadata such as authors and publication dates. The API employs advanced natural language processing techniques to ensure high-quality output.
Typical use cases include news aggregation, sentiment analysis, and content recommendation systems. The API is designed for ease of integration, making it suitable for developers and data analysts alike.

2. Text Extractor From URL API
The Text Extractor From URL API is a powerful tool that scrapes the text contained in a given URL, providing just the content without any navigation, comments, headers, or footers. This API is particularly beneficial for content creators looking to extract text from various websites quickly.
Key features include:
- Get Text: Users can pass a URL (which must be longer than 500 characters) to retrieve the text content. This feature is ideal for extracting information from articles or blogs on the fly.
Common use cases involve content aggregation and information retrieval for research purposes. The API's straightforward implementation allows developers to integrate it seamlessly into their applications.

3. Doc to Text API
The Doc to Text API is designed for seamless document conversion, allowing users to transform various formats, including DOC, PDF, and images, into plain text and HTML. This API is particularly useful for both small tasks and large-scale projects, offering advanced OCR and email parsing capabilities.
Key features include:
- Extract Text: Users can send files for extraction, supporting a wide range of formats such as DOC, PDF, and images. This feature is essential for converting documents into usable text for further analysis.
Typical use cases include digital archiving, data analysis, and content aggregation. The API's flexibility in handling various formats makes it a valuable tool for developers.

4. PDF Text Extractor API
The PDF Text Extractor API offers a simple solution for converting PDF files into plain text. This API allows users to quickly extract text from PDFs, making it an excellent tool for text analysis, data extraction, and document processing.
Key features include:
- PDF to Text: Users can pass the PDF URL to receive the extracted text. This feature is particularly useful for analyzing the content of PDF documents without manual data entry.
Common use cases include sentiment analysis, data extraction for spreadsheets, and document processing for editing. The API's ability to handle complex layouts ensures accurate text extraction.

5. Text Entities Extractor API
The Text Entities Extractor API enables users to extract user-defined entities from unstructured text. This API harnesses the power of AI to identify specific values such as prices and dates, as well as semantic answers like main topics or customer requests.
Key features include:
- Get Entities: Users can input text up to 50,000 characters long and define up to 12 custom query entities to extract. This feature allows for tailored extraction based on specific needs.
Typical use cases include market research, customer support, and data analysis. The API's versatility makes it suitable for various applications across different industries.
